COLM KEAVENEY IN FRESH ROW WITH LABOUR PARTY

Date Published: 28-Dec-2012

A Labour spokesman has rejected comments by Galway East TD Colm Keaveney that the party is about to set up a “kangaroo court” to remove his membership.

Deputy Keaveney lost the party whip when he voted against social welfare cuts in the budget but still remains as party chairman

The Tuam based TD says there are suggestions that in order to remove him as chairman the party would have to remove his membership

Deputy Keaveney says it would be poor judgment by Eamon Gilmore to underestimate the democratic primacy of grassroots members.”

However a Labour spokesman says the suggestion is “entirely without foundation”.
